Cursor 3 web interface for Background Agents shows wrong model and can't change models

Where does the bug appear (feature/product)?

Background Agent (GitHub, Slack, Web, Linear)

Describe the Bug

The web interface to control background agents has a bug where it (a) shows that the current model is “GPT 5.3 High” and (b) doesn’t allow you to change the model.

I’ve confirmed that this is indeed not the model used for the session by checking usage (which shows I am using Composer 2) and when I look at the same conversation in Cursor 3 Glass I also see “Composer 2” as the model not “GPT 5.3”.

Steps to Reproduce

  1. start a conversataion/agent locally with Composer 2 as the model.
  2. Move to > Cloud for the current conversation.
  3. Go to the web interface (cursor.com/agents) and check which model is being used.

Expected Behavior

I would expect to have a model drop-down that allows me to pick the model and that the model shown matches the model that is actually used.

Hey, thanks for the detailed report. This is a known issue. When a chat is moved from the IDE to the cloud web UI at cursor.com/agents, it can show the wrong model name. The agent is actually running on the model you selected in the IDE, in your case Composer 2. It’s just the display that’s wrong.

About not being able to change the model in the dropdown on cursor.com/agents, the team is aware of that too. I’ve shared your report to help with prioritization. There’s no ETA yet, but we’ll update the thread if there’s any news.
